Output 81d53f0d86b77b21bb4f684be745ae35b7518556535280e0b6fa39e0753b34d9:22

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d42e45ff5844d357adf7a3d230f1623db93325afee96b86eb385f4dc2bf8dcfc
address
bc1p6shytl6cgnf40t0h50frputz8kunxfd0a6ttsm4nsh6dc2lcmn7qy6qyxz
transaction
81d53f0d86b77b21bb4f684be745ae35b7518556535280e0b6fa39e0753b34d9
spent
true